Your Role as a Territory Sales Representative

As a Territory Sales Representative, your day will be a dynamic blend of sales, service, and problem-solving, both in the store and out in the field. Responsibilities include:

  • Providing sales and product support for industrial, construction, and residential construction equipment
  • Prospecting for new accounts, fostering current customer relationships, and continuing to grow opportunities with new and existing customers by taking a consultative sales approach to provide value to customers
  • Providing a great customer experience through your knowledge of Acme Tools' product offerings, service capabilities, and current programs
  • Identifying customers' opportunities and making product or service recommendations that will meet their needs
  • Scheduling appointments to meet with and present products at customers' work sites or businesses
  • Showcasing items through product demonstrations prior to the sale
  • Walking customers through starting procedures and breaking-in periods once product is purchased
  • Following up after the sale to ensure customers are satisfied with their purchase and resolving any potential issues they may have
  • Participating during store events (physical inventories, sales meetings, trade shows, special sales, etc.)
  • Operating and maintaining a company vehicle and any provided technology resources
  • Maintaining a safe and secure work environment by adhering to and striving to improve safety standards and reporting suspicious activity
  • Completing related tasks as assigned

 

Qualifications

  • 2+ years of direct customer service experience, preferably in outside sales
  • Excellent customer service and communication skills
  • Prior knowledge or use of tools and equipment
  • Strong computer skills and ability to learn new software
  • Valid Driver’s License with a clean driving record
  • The ability to work in-store on Saturdays as business dictates

 

Physical Requirements

  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s.
  • Ability to look at a computer screen for extended periods of time
  • Ability to frequently push, pull, squat, bend, and reach

 

About Acme Tools

For over 75 years, Acme Tools has been a trusted source for tools and equipment throughout North Dakota, Minnesota, Iowa, and online. Serving contractors, woodworkers, and DIY enthusiasts, we offer top-quality tools from the best brands. As a family-owned business, we're proud to foster a culture that's employee-focused, involved in our community, and committed to growth.
